Experimental and numerical analyses of timber-concrete shear connection

摘要:This paper presents some experimental results of timber-concrete connection made with steel tube considering push-out test, to represent the shear behaviour at the interface between concrete and timber in timber-concrete composite floor. The ductile behaviour is observed and the final failure occurs after a large deformation of the tube and timber that surrounds tube. The concrete is subjected to crushing under the connector and the crack appears on the surface. The experimental results show a significant dispersion of rigidity but lower dispersion of resistance. These results are used to evaluate a three-dimensional (3D) non-linear finite element model, which incorporates the material and geometric nonlinearity, and contact. The comparison with experimental results shows the good qualities of the numerical model. It can be used to predict the ultimate load, identify the location of the initial cracking and simulate the failure mode in timber member.
